New York’s
Orange County Airport is an untowered
general aviation airport located 1 mile (2
km) southwest of
village of
Montgomery, in the
Town of Montgomery,
New York. The 526-acre (2.1 km²) airport is owned by
Orange County and can be found at the junction of state highways
211 and
NY-416.
It is a popular place for aspiring local
pilots to learn to fly or practice their skills. With 125,000
takeoffs and
landings annually, it's New York's second-busiest general-aviation airport.
Transmissions between pilots and the airport are rebroadcast on a one-watt station at 88.1
megahertz, so it's possible to tune into them on a standard car radio while driving in the vicinity.
Facilities and aircraft
Orange County Airport covers an area of 528
acres (214
ha) which contains two
asphalt paved
runways: 3/21 measuring 5,006 x 100 ft. (1,526 x 30 m) and 8/26 measuring 3,672 x 100 ft. (1,119 x 30 m).
For the 12-month period ending August 1, 2007, the airport had 120,000 aircraft operations, an average of 328 per day: 97%
general aviation, 2%
air taxi and 1% military. There are 228 aircraft based at this airport: 90% single-engine, 9% multi-engine, 1% jet and <1%
helicopter.
